Listen in Prayer

Listen for God’s voice in everything you do, everywhere you go; He’s the one who will keep you on track. –Proverbs 3:6 MSG

Communication is a two-way street. It involves listening as well as speaking. Yet, during prayer time with the Lord, you may tend to do most or all of the talking by spending this solemn time praising and thanking Him for His wondrous love, requesting help for yourself and others, and asking for forgiveness. These practices are essential.But how much time is devoted to actually listening for God’s response? God speaks to His children in many ways, and one of these avenues is through prayer. It is vital in a relationship with the Lord to take the time to hear His response.During prayer, patiently allow time for God to calm your fears and strengthen you for the day ahead. He may bring to mind a direction to take, a solution to a problem, or a Scripture verse that is relevant to your situation. In Psalm 37:7 (NIV), we are directed to “Be still before the Lord, and wait patiently for Him.” Use the words of Samuel, as he did, during prayer time, “Speak. I’m your servant, ready to listen” (1 Samuel 3:10 MSG).
